In a dual-processor configuration, the memory configuration for each processor must be identical.

Memory modules of different sizes can be mixed within a memory channel (for example, 2-GB, 8-GB, and 4-GB), but all populated channels must have identical configurations.

For Optimizer Mode, memory modules are installed in the numeric order of the sockets beginning with A1 or B1.

For Memory Mirroring or Advanced ECC Mode, the three sockets furthest from the processor are unused and memory modules are installed beginning with socket A2 or B2 and proceeding in the numeric order of the remaining sockets (for example, A2, A3, A5, A6, A8, and A9).

Advanced ECC Mode requires x4 or x8 DRAM device widths.

The memory speed of each channel depends on the memory configuration:

For single or dual-rank memory modules:

One memory module per channel supports up to 1333 MHz.

Two memory modules per channel supports up to 1067 MHz.

Three memory modules per channel are limited to 800 MHz, regardless of memory module speed.

For quad-rank memory modules:

One memory module per channel supports up to 1067 MHz.

Two memory modules per channel are limited to 800 MHz, regardless of memory module speed.

If a quad-rank memory module is installed, then only one other memory module can be added to that channel.

If quad-rank memory modules are mixed with single- or dual-rank modules, the quad-rank modules must be installed in the sockets with the white release levers.

If memory modules with different speeds are installed, they will operate at the speed of the slowest installed memory module(s).

R710 specifications

The Dell PowerEdge R710 is a highly versatile and robust server that has been a popular choice for businesses seeking reliable performance and efficient management. Launched as part of Dell’s 11th generation PowerEdge line, the R710 is designed to handle various workloads, making it ideal for virtualization, data analysis, and enterprise applications.

One of the standout features of the R710 is its support for dual Intel Xeon 5500 or 5600 series processors. This capability allows for substantial processing power and improved energy efficiency through Intel’s Nehalem architecture. The server can accommodate up to 128GB of DDR3 RAM across its 16 DIMM slots, delivering the memory capacity needed for demanding applications while also providing the performance enhancements of higher memory speeds.

The R710 also boasts an impressive array of storage options. It supports up to eight 2.5-inch or six 3.5-inch hard drives, which can be configured in various RAID levels for enhanced data protection and performance. The server is compatible with both SAS and SATA drives, providing flexibility for different storage needs. Additionally, the optional PERC (PowerEdge RAID Controller) allows for enhanced RAID configurations, ensuring data integrity and performance optimization.

In terms of connectivity, the Dell R710 comes equipped with four Gigabit Ethernet ports for high-speed networking. This connectivity facilitates effective communication in virtualized and clustered environments. The server is also built with optional iDRAC (Integrated Dell Remote Access Controller) technology, which provides administrators with advanced management capabilities, remote control, and monitoring features that simplify server administration, minimize downtime, and enhance overall productivity.

Thermal efficiency is another key characteristic of the R710. Its innovative cooling design features intelligent fans that optimize airflow based on workload demands, ensuring that the system runs at optimal temperatures while minimizing energy consumption. This contributes to reduced operating costs and a smaller environmental footprint.

The modular design of the R710 allows for easy upgrades and maintenance, making it a practical option for IT departments. The server’s support for various operating systems, including Windows Server and various distributions of Linux, ensures compatibility with diverse environments.
